Geode Capital Management LLC Has $299.70 Million Stock Position in Hasbro, Inc. $HAS

Geode Capital Management LLC boosted its holdings in shares of Hasbro, Inc. (NASDAQ:HASFree Report) by 3.5%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 3,661,020 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 122,592 shares during the period. Geode Capital Management LLC owned approximately 2.61% of Hasbro worth $299,700,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Hasbro (NASDAQ:HASG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, May 20th. The company reported $1.47 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.20 by $0.27. Hasbro had a positive return on equity of 174.64% and a negative net margin of 4.62%.The firm had revenue of $1 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$969.20 million.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$1.04 EPS.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 12.7% compared to the same quarter last year. Research analysts predict that Hasbro, Inc. will post 5.96 earnings per share for the current year.

Hasbro Company Profile

(Free Report)

Hasbro, Inc is a global play and entertainment company, known for designing, manufacturing and marketing a diverse portfolio of toys, games and consumer products. Founded in 1923 as Hassenfeld Brothers and headquartered in Pawtucket, Rhode Island, the company has grown into one of the foremost names in the toy industry, with a presence in retail, digital and entertainment channels worldwide.

The company’s brand portfolio features iconic properties such as Monopoly, Play-Doh, Nerf, My Little Pony and Transformers.
